Around the FMEA desk, list the incidence ranking for each cause. For each bring about, establish recent procedure controls. These are tests, processes or mechanisms that you choose to now have set up to help keep failures from achieving the customer. These controls could possibly stop the bring about from taking place, decrease the probability that it'll happen or detect failure following the cause has by now transpired but right before The shopper is afflicted. For each Command, determine the detection rating, or D. This rating estimates how effectively the controls can detect either the lead to or its failure mode after they have took place but prior to The client is influenced. Detection is usually rated on a scale from 1 to 10, in which one usually means the Manage is absolutely certain to detect the trouble and 10 indicates the Manage is certain never to detect the condition (or no Command exists). Over the FMEA desk, listing the detection score for every induce.
